Unlike standard Windows 10 editions (Home or Pro), which receive major feature updates twice a year, an LTSC release is a fixed version with no feature updates. For Windows 10 LTSC 2019, this means the operating system is based on the Windows 10 Pro version and will never be upgraded to a newer feature version, such as 20H2 or 21H2. However, this stability does not come at the expense of security. Throughout its lifecycle, LTSC editions continue to receive crucial monthly quality and security updates to protect systems from vulnerabilities. The only thing that remains static is the feature set.

Third-party developers who create "Lite" versions often use automated tools to rip out core Windows components, such as the Windows Update framework, side-by-side (WinSxS) assemblies, or cryptographic services. Removing these components can cause future software installations, drivers, and security patches to fail entirely. : Stands for Long-Term Servicing Channel. This is a servicing option for Windows 10 Enterprise that provides a stable and unchanged build for a long period, typically for 5 years from its release date, plus an additional 5 years of extended support. This option is ideal for devices that don't need feature updates but require long-term stability and security.
